Why Drainage Is the Cheapest Foundation Fix in Round Rock

Published 2026-05-21 · Foundation Round Rock

Most foundation damage in Round Rock starts with water, not the slab itself. Fixing how water moves around your home is often the cheapest way to avoid a five figure pier job later.

Water is what moves the clay

The expansive clay under most Round Rock neighborhoods swells when it gets wet and shrinks when it dries. When water pools on one side of your slab, that section of clay expands more than the rest of the yard, and the foundation tilts. Control the water and you control most of the movement.

Grading comes first

The soil against your foundation should slope away from the house, dropping about six inches over the first ten feet. A lot of homes near Brushy Creek and the older blocks east of I-35 have settled or eroded grading that now sends water back toward the slab. Re-grading is cheap compared to piers and often the single most effective fix.

Gutters and downspouts

A downspout that dumps right at the corner of the house is a foundation problem waiting to happen. Extensions that carry water four to six feet out keep that corner from swelling every time it rains. Clean gutters matter too, because an overflow during a heavy Central Texas storm soaks the perimeter fast.

French drains for the stubborn spots

If part of your yard stays soggy or water collects against the slab no matter what, a French drain intercepts it and carries it away. This is common on lots that back up to greenbelts or sit lower than the street, like parts of Forest Creek and Teravista.

When drainage is not enough

If your slab has already settled, doors stick, and cracks are growing, drainage alone will not lift it back. At that point you need an evaluation for piers. But fixing the drainage at the same time keeps the repair from failing again. The cheapest foundation work is the water problem you solve before it ever reaches the slab.
